Good to hear :-) There's a different situation in our case, the german dvd/cd-roms use a complex GUI in xhtml (win disks come with an onboard k-meleon browser and installation feature via menu) and would need a complete redesign of CSS and content for 3.3 and we can hardly handle both - so we agreed to concentrate on LO for now. We are thinking of a new maybe CMS based structure of the GUI which is exported on demand on a disk and should be easy to translate and filled with localized content - useful for all. Naturally the english version is in place for a prototype and the content is on your isos already. The new GUI could be very basic with just necessary text for it could easily be approved even step by step via CSS. Once we have localized versions of LO the language teams could manage their texts and content on paralell versions of the localized GUI and folder tree online and export a static snapshot-iso on demand.
